This document assists in inspecting indoor or outdoor stairs, railings, landings, treads, and related conditions for safety and proper
construction: the table shown in this document outlines some of the information we collect during a field investigation
of the condition of an interior or exterior stairway for safety defects. Having investigated several cases of severe
injury related to falls and railing collapses I developed this field data collection checklist.

Odd dimensions of stair tread width, height, depth, nose, low or flimsy stair railings, loose stair components,
and a host of other stair and railing defects are the source of more injuries and more lost time from work
in the United States (and probably other countries) than any other source of injuries after automobile accidents.
If you see a silly railing such as the one in this photograph it may indicate an approach to stair building
that is a red alert for other hazards. Stair kits and manufactured stairs can be expected to meet
accepted standards for safety but watch out for amateur installations and particularly for site-built stairs
in oddly-shaped locations or in areas of no building code enforcement. This stair inspection checklist assists anyone who
wants to inspect a stairwell by providing a means to document the pertinent measurements, inconsistencies
in dimensions, or other stair and railing hazards or defects.

Notes to Table: 1st Tread = bottom Structural conditions to
observe include connections, proper number and type of fastener, spans, condition of materials. Subtle details such as a
wooden exterior stair tread installed upside down (bark side down) can lead to cupping which can cause algae or ice and
a subsequent slip and trip hazard. Circular stairs pose special problems concerning tread shape, potential walking
area, railing design. Handrails pose special considerations beyond height and security, such as graspability, shape,
condition. Report other construction details, structural connections, modifications, loose connections, support, posts,
weather exposure/covering, weathering, rot, tread damage, tread nose wear/damage, moss, algae, cupping, splitting, tread
connection and support (below), rail obstructions, rail grip, stairway obstructions, permits & "CO"
obtained/missing)
